How the 3.64% Federal Funds Rate Influences Commercial Equipment Financing

The federal funds rate doesn’t directly set the interest rate you’ll pay on manufacturing equipment loans, but it establishes the foundation upon which commercial lending rates are built. Think of it as the baseline cost of money in the economy—everything else gets priced from there.

In 2026, the 3.64% federal funds rate represents a moderate lending environment. We’re well off the near-zero rates that characterized the early 2020s, but we’re also significantly below the peaks we saw during aggressive tightening cycles. For equipment financing, this translates to commercial rates typically ranging from 6.5% to 11%, depending on your credit profile, collateral value, and loan structure.

Here’s what matters for EV battery manufacturers: lenders add their spread based on perceived risk. Green energy equipment financing often receives favorable treatment because the sector shows strong growth trajectories and government support. However, the specialized nature of battery manufacturing equipment can work against you—if the equipment has limited alternative uses, lenders may price in higher risk premiums.

The federal rate environment also affects the availability of capital. At 3.64%, banks and alternative lenders have sufficient incentive to deploy capital while businesses can still afford to borrow. This creates a window of opportunity for manufacturers to secure competitive financing before potential rate increases.

Equipment Financing Structures for Battery Manufacturing Operations

Manufacturing equipment loans come in several structures, each with distinct advantages depending on your operational needs and financial position.

Traditional Equipment Loans provide straightforward ownership. You borrow a lump sum, purchase the equipment outright, and repay over a fixed term (typically 3-7 years for manufacturing equipment). The equipment serves as collateral, which generally results in lower rates than unsecured financing. For established manufacturers with strong credit profiles, this structure often delivers the lowest total cost of capital.

Equipment Leasing preserves capital and offers tax advantages through deduction of lease payments. Operating leases keep equipment off your balance sheet, which can improve financial ratios important to other lenders or investors. Capital leases build toward ownership while still providing cash flow advantages. For rapidly evolving battery technology, leasing provides flexibility to upgrade equipment without being stuck with obsolete assets.

SBA 504 Loans can finance up to 40% of eligible equipment purchases with below-market fixed rates and terms extending to 10 or 20 years. These government-backed loans are particularly attractive for green energy equipment financing, as the SBA has specific programs supporting environmentally beneficial businesses. The longer terms reduce monthly payments, improving cash flow during your growth phase.

Sale-Leaseback Arrangements allow you to convert already-owned equipment into working capital by selling it to a financing company and leasing it back. If you’ve already purchased equipment with cash or short-term financing, this strategy can free up capital for operational expenses or additional expansion.

The optimal structure depends on your specific situation. A startup EV battery recycler with limited operating history might benefit from leasing’s lower upfront costs and balance sheet advantages. An established manufacturer expanding capacity might prefer the straightforward ownership and lower total cost of a traditional equipment loan.

Green Energy Equipment Loans: Special Considerations for Battery Manufacturers

The intersection of green energy and advanced manufacturing creates unique financing considerations. Several factors work in your favor when seeking commercial equipment financing rates for EV battery operations.

Government Support Programs at federal and state levels provide guarantees, grants, and favorable loan terms for green energy manufacturing. The Infrastructure Investment and Jobs Act and Inflation Reduction Act continue to influence lending in 2026, with various tax credits and incentives that improve your project economics. These programs don’t just provide direct benefits—they also signal to private lenders that your sector has government backing, reducing perceived risk.

ESG Lending Initiatives have matured significantly. Many institutional lenders now offer preferential rates for equipment that demonstrably reduces carbon emissions or supports the clean energy transition. Battery manufacturing and recycling operations qualify for these programs, potentially shaving 50-100 basis points off your rate.

Industry Growth Projections work in your favor during underwriting. Lenders evaluate not just your current financials but your sector’s trajectory. With major automakers committing to EV production and battery demand far outstripping supply, lenders view this sector more favorably than mature or declining industries.

However, challenges exist. The specialized nature of battery manufacturing equipment means lower liquidation values if something goes wrong. Lenders compensate for this with higher down payment requirements (often 15-20% versus 10% for general manufacturing equipment) or additional collateral requirements.

Technology obsolescence represents another concern. Battery chemistry and manufacturing processes continue evolving rapidly. Lenders worry about financing equipment that might become outdated before the loan matures. Addressing this concern requires demonstrating either that your equipment handles multiple battery chemistries or that your technology roadmap accounts for evolution.

Qualifying for Equipment Financing in the Current Rate Environment

Securing favorable manufacturing equipment loans requires preparation across several dimensions. Lenders evaluate both your business fundamentals and the specific equipment investment.

Credit Profile remains paramount. Personal credit scores above 680 and business credit scores demonstrating consistent payment history significantly improve your options. In the current rate environment, the difference between good credit and excellent credit might be 200 basis points on your rate—thousands of dollars monthly on a multi-million-dollar equipment purchase.

Financial Statements need to demonstrate ability to service debt. Lenders typically want to see debt service coverage ratios of at least 1.25x, meaning your cash flow exceeds your debt payments by 25%. For startup operations without operating history, this means your projections must be thoroughly documented and defensible.

Down Payment Capacity signals commitment and reduces lender risk. While some equipment financing programs offer up to 100% financing, having 10-20% down payment capability expands your options and improves your terms.

Equipment Documentation should include detailed specifications, vendor quotes, and expected useful life. For used equipment, appraisals establish collateral value. The more thoroughly you document the equipment’s role in your operation and its value retention, the more comfortable lenders become.

Business Plan and Projections matter especially for newer operations or significant expansions. Lenders need to understand your market position, customer contracts or letters of intent, competitive advantages, and realistic growth trajectory. In the EV battery sector, demonstrating secured supply agreements or off-take contracts dramatically strengthens your application.

Working with Multiple Lenders to Optimize Your Equipment Financing

The complexity of manufacturing equipment loans means no single lender serves every situation optimally. Banks, credit unions, equipment financing specialists, and alternative lenders each have different credit appetites, rate structures, and program features.

Traditional banks often provide the lowest rates for borrowers with strong credit and established operating history. They typically prefer larger loan amounts ($500,000+) and may have existing relationships that smooth the approval process. However, their underwriting can be rigid, and they may struggle with newer businesses or non-traditional collateral situations.

Equipment financing companies specialize in the nuances of machinery lending. They understand residual values, technology obsolescence, and industry-specific factors better than generalist lenders. Their rates might be slightly higher than banks, but their approval rates and speed often exceed traditional lenders.

Alternative lenders fill gaps in the market, serving borrowers who don’t fit traditional credit boxes. Their rates run higher (often 9-15% for equipment financing), but they can approve deals that banks decline and often move much faster.

Credit unions sometimes offer competitive rates for members and may have specific programs supporting green energy or manufacturing. Their loan sizes typically cap lower than commercial banks, but for small to mid-sized equipment purchases, they can be excellent options.

The optimal strategy involves parallel applications to multiple lender types. This approach provides leverage during negotiations, ensures you have backup options if a preferred lender encounters issues, and helps you understand the full range of available terms. However, managing multiple applications requires coordination to avoid excessive credit inquiries and inconsistent information across applications.

Real-World Equipment Financing Scenarios for Battery Manufacturers

Understanding how equipment financing works in practice helps clarify your options. Consider these representative scenarios:

Scenario 1: Established Recycler Expanding Capacity - A battery recycling operation with three years of profitable operations needs $8 million in additional processing equipment. Strong financials (EBITDA of $2.5 million, debt service coverage ratio of 1.8x) and excellent credit (personal 780, business 85) positioned them for optimal terms. They secured a 7-year equipment loan at 7.2% with 15% down payment. Monthly payments of approximately $104,000 fit comfortably within cash flow, and the equipment increased processing capacity by 60%.

Scenario 2: Startup Cell Manufacturer with Strong Backing - A new battery cell manufacturer with experienced leadership and $5 million in equity investment needed $12 million in manufacturing equipment. Without operating history, traditional bank financing wasn’t available. An equipment financing company offered a capital lease structure at 9.8% over 5 years, with payments of approximately $255,000 monthly. The higher rate reflected startup risk, but the deal closed in 3 weeks, allowing the company to meet their production timeline.

Scenario 3: Mid-Sized Manufacturer Upgrading Technology - A manufacturer with adequate but aging equipment needed $4.5 million to upgrade to current-generation coating and assembly systems. Rather than depleting cash reserves, they executed a sale-leaseback on existing equipment (generating $2 million in working capital) and financed the new equipment through an SBA 504 loan at 6.8% over 10 years. The extended term reduced monthly payments to approximately $52,000, and the SBA structure’s favorable terms offset the additional complexity.

These scenarios illustrate how different situations require different financing approaches. Your specific circumstances—operating history, credit profile, equipment type, and strategic objectives—determine the optimal structure.

Federal Funds Rate Impact: What Changes Mean for Your Financing

The federal funds rate doesn’t remain static, and understanding how potential changes affect your equipment financing helps with strategic planning.

If rates decrease from the current 3.64%, commercial equipment financing rates typically follow downward with a lag of 1-3 months. Variable-rate financing benefits immediately, while fixed-rate loans only help new borrowers. If you anticipate rate decreases, variable-rate structures or shorter-term loans you can refinance become more attractive.

If rates increase, existing fixed-rate financing becomes more valuable—you’ve locked in lower costs while new borrowers pay more. This creates competitive advantages if you’ve financed efficiently while competitors delayed. Variable-rate loans become more expensive, potentially impacting cash flow.

The relationship isn’t perfectly linear. A 0.25% change in the federal funds rate might translate to 0.15-0.30% change in commercial equipment financing rates, depending on broader credit conditions. During periods of economic uncertainty, lender spreads often widen even if the base rate remains stable.

For battery manufacturers, the sector’s growth trajectory provides some insulation from rate increases. Strong demand and favorable industry fundamentals mean lenders remain interested even in higher-rate environments. However, higher rates do impact project economics, potentially delaying marginal investments or requiring larger down payments to maintain acceptable debt service coverage.

The practical implication: don’t try to time rate movements perfectly, but do understand that the current environment is reasonably favorable for equipment financing. Waiting for rates to drop further might mean missing production opportunities that more than offset slightly higher financing costs.

FAQ: Equipment Financing for EV Battery Manufacturing

What credit score do I need for manufacturing equipment loans?

Most traditional lenders require personal credit scores of at least 680 and business credit scores above 70 for competitive equipment financing rates. Scores of 720+ personal and 80+ business typically qualify for the best terms. However, specialized equipment financing companies may approve deals with scores as low as 600, though at significantly higher rates (often 12-18%). For EV battery manufacturing specifically, strong sector fundamentals can sometimes offset moderate credit challenges, particularly if you have secured customer contracts or proven technology.

How does equipment financing differ from traditional business loans?

Equipment financing uses the purchased equipment as collateral, which typically results in higher approval rates and lower rates than unsecured business loans. The equipment itself reduces lender risk—if you default, they can repossess and sell the machinery to recover their investment. This collateralized structure means you can often borrow larger amounts relative to your revenue or credit profile than with general business loans.
